Cupboards are often an aspect to optimize in this room. It often happens that we forget certain foods at the back of the cupboard, buy duplicate products, or discover expired foods after a certain time. These situations can cause a feeling of waste. Rest assured, it happens to everyone and there are solutions to avoid these inconveniences.
It was Gaëlle Lamoureux who shared her brilliant idea in this video on her Instagram account. She added telescoping drawers to these cabinets because she didn’t have the budget to install rails in her pantry. There, she got it for less than 60 euros on Amazon.
In addition, no need to drill or take out your toolbox, they are installed with double-sided self-adhesive strips directly on the bottom board. Thanks to this accessory you have access to all the food, even those behind it, you can immediately see everything that is there without having to rummage around and your storage space is better organized.
